After No. 8 Georgia's 24-17 win against No. 6 Florida on Saturday, the Bulldogs inched ever closer to a coveted College Football Playoff berth, as they solidified their spot as at least a top three team in the SEC, behind Alabama and LSU.

However, because of their close loss against South Carolina two weeks ago, the Bulldogs are most likely still knocking on the door of the playoffs.

Even so, anything is possible in the landscape of college football. If Jake Fromm can lead the Bulldogs to a dominant finish to the season, and one of the top-ranked teams somehow loses a game at all, the Bulldogs may find themselves in consideration for a playoff spot from the CFB committee.

They still have plenty of competition from their fellow one-loss teams, including Oregon and Oklahoma, but a huge win today over Florida will see the Bulldogs move up the NCAA rankings and into the minds of voters.

If the CFB Playoff committee truly claims to look at the full resume of each contending team, they'll weigh Georgia's victory over Florida highly within the context of rankings, and perhaps it might push them over the edge at the end of the season.

It's up to Georgia to stay as a one-loss team. Only then will they have a shot at a playoff berth.
